Plainclothesmen pick up three in Kabirwala: No let-up in disappearances

MULTAN: Plainclothesmen reportedly took three people into custody in Kabirwala in Khanewal district on Wednesday and Thursday. According to eyewitnesses, Naseem Rajput, 40, was at his shop around 10am on Thursday when 10 to 12 plainclothesmen along with DSP Dawood Hasnain came to his shop and asked for his cell phone number. Later, they took him away. His younger brother Akhtar Rajput and a shopkeeper, Zahoor Ahmed, went to the DSP’s office to know the cause of his arrest. They did not return till the filing of this report.

Naseem, who actually belongs to Khangarh in Muzaffargarh district, used to live in Karachi. He left Karachi 18 years ago and started living in Kabirwala. He set up a cloth shop opposite Imambargah Areaanwala, Kutchery Road. On Wednesday, some plainclothesmen also took two people, unidentified so far, into custody on Khanewal Road, Kabirwala.

Meanwhile, police had called Tanveer, alias Tanni Khan and Shabbir Fauji on Monday night to the DSP’s office and questioned them. Former members of the outlawed Lashkar-i-Jhangvi, Tanni and Fauji had carried Rs2 million and Rs1 million head money. Courts had released them after no evidence was found against them. Kabirwala city police SHO Rao Rashid expressed his ignorance about both the incidents and said no one had complained or informed him about the kidnap or arrest of the people.

DSP Dawood Hasnain, however, told this correspondent that the police had summoned them because a team of a secret agency wanted to question them. He said that the police had allowed them to go before the Fajr prayers. He said the police had not arrested them rather they had sought some information from them. He said that not a single person had been arrested or kidnapped in Kabirwala. He denied that Zahoor Ahmed and Akhtar had approached him. The DSP said that he was at the wedding of the sister of Tanveer, alias Tanni Khan, on Wednesday and denied his presence at the time of the arrest of the three. He also denied that such an incident had taken place.

Tanveer, alias Tanni Khan, told Dawn that he was busy in arrangements for his sister’s wedding when he received calls from DPO Shahid Hanif and DSP Dawood Hasnain just a day before her marriage. They asked him to come to the police station along with Shabbir Fauji because a team of ISI wanted some information from him. He said the police informed him that an ISI team was in Kabirwala. He said the team told the police that it had information that Tanveer, alias Tanni Khan, Shabbir Fauji and an unidentified person were planning a bomb attack on an imambargah to avenge Saddam Hussein’s execution. He said courts had declared them innocent but the police were keeping an eye on their activities. He said the police had raided Darul Aloom, Kabirwala and questioned caretaker Mufti Irshad.
